Melania Trump has mostly stayed out of the spotlight since Donald Trump returned to the White House earlier this year. It’s now being reported that she has spent fewer than 14 days at the White House since Trump’s second inauguration on January 20, 2025.
While many wonder why she’s barely seen in public or beside her husband, those close to the couple say she’s been spending more time with him lately—and their son Barron is a big part of the reason why.
Their marriage has had its ups and downs, especially after Trump’s recent legal troubles. Last year, Melania was reportedly furious about the case involving adult film actress Stormy Daniels, who claimed she had an affair with Trump back in 2006, just one year after he married Melania.
Trump denied the allegations, but the trial still took a toll on their relationship. According to journalist Mary Jordan, Melania was extremely upset and the whole situation marked a very low point for her.
Oddly enough, those same legal challenges seem to have brought the couple closer together. Mary Jordan says Melania believes her husband is being unfairly targeted and has grown more protective of him. That shared struggle has helped them reconnect. She explained that while Melania prefers to stay out of the spotlight, she and Donald are spending more time together now than they have in the past. And Barron, their 19-year-old son, plays a key role in that change.
Melania has always been very close to Barron. During Trump’s first term, she delayed moving into the White House so Barron could finish the school year in New York. This time, it’s no different she’s splitting her time between Washington, Florida, and New York, where Barron is now in college.
Reports say she’s deeply concerned about his safety, especially after the attempted assassination on Trump last year and a more recent incident where a gunman approached him on a golf course. These events reportedly left Melania shaken and more determined than ever to keep her son safe.
Even though Melania doesn’t appear in public much, she recently made a rare appearance with Donald when they attended the funeral of Pope Francis in Rome. The couple was seen walking hand-in-hand through the Vatican and appeared affectionate, offering a glimpse of unity. That trip also took place on Melania’s 55th birthday, showing that despite their struggles, they are finding ways to be together.
